Kwang-Eun Ko is a scholar working on Cognitive Neuroscience, Computer Vision and Pattern Recognition and Signal Processing. According to data from OpenAlex, Kwang-Eun Ko has authored 68 papers receiving a total of 538 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Cognitive Neuroscience, 21 papers in Computer Vision and Pattern Recognition and 17 papers in Signal Processing. Recurrent topics in Kwang-Eun Ko's work include EEG and Brain-Computer Interfaces (23 papers), Blind Source Separation Techniques (13 papers) and Face recognition and analysis (10 papers). Kwang-Eun Ko is often cited by papers focused on EEG and Brain-Computer Interfaces (23 papers), Blind Source Separation Techniques (13 papers) and Face recognition and analysis (10 papers). Kwang-Eun Ko collaborates with scholars based in South Korea, Bulgaria and Greece. Kwang-Eun Ko's co-authors include Kwee-Bo Sim, Seung Min Park, Jaehyeon Kang, Byeong‐Kwon Ju, Seung Min Park, Jeong‐Ho Lim, Jeong Hee Choi, Jung-Hoon Hwang, Young-Hwan Lee and Xinyang Yu and has published in prestigious journals such as Sensors, Computers and Electronics in Agriculture and Electronics Letters.
